## Ticket: Config drift on PointsKeeper ledger

The staging and production instances of the PointsKeeper loyalty ledger have drifted: retention windows and signing intervals no longer match the baseline committed last quarter. This matters for audit integrity, so flagging for security review before we reconcile. The values currently live in production are captured below.

config for kafof-bawef:
holath:
  log_level: debug
  metrics_host: metrics.holath.qorvelsys.internal
  pin: 2191
  pool_size: 32

**Ticket: Config drift on Garagemeter occupancy feed**

Hey, flagging this for security review. The Lornbeck Deck feed started double-counting exits last week, and it turns out prod no longer matches what's in the Quarry repo — someone hand-edited the poller live. No change record, naturally. Before we reconcile, please eyeball the values currently running in prod:

deployment values, kajep-kageg:
[praix]
host = praix.paliqcorp.corp
user = praix_svc
database = praix_prod

## Contrast audit setup

Welcome aboard. The Tonelark audit suite checks every rendered view against WCAG contrast thresholds. Copy `env.sample` to `.env`, then set `AUDIT_VIEWPORTS` (comma-separated sizes) and `AUDIT_THRESHOLD=4.5`. Run `make audit` to confirm your setup before touching components. The suite uploads results to our dashboard, authenticated by the token entered on the next line.

secret setting of yafof-tawep: RELAY_SECRET8=8abb5772

Effective this quarter, Marlowe Instruments has paused all external hiring within the Coastal Systems Division. Backfills for critical safety roles may proceed with written approval from divisional HR. Branch managers should review open requisitions by Friday and flag any that affect contractual deliverables in the Harlem Bay program. Internal transfers remain permitted. Please handle staff questions with care and route escalations through your regional lead. The rationale is summarized below.

board note of bajop-yaweg: The western region missed its Pelys quota by 58.0 percent last quarter. Pelysek Foods plans to raise the Belius list price by 44.0 percent in July. The steering committee signed off on a budget of $133.8 million for Project Pelax. The renewal with Zoraelix Systems closes at $61.9 million a year, 12.7 percent above the last contract.